I am hopping to use a few of these to charge up a set of car batteries along with a 500W solar power set up.
We get a nominal 11-12v out of the Weza at a Maximum of 10A, Although the Battery is only rated at 7A.
During the test i can see that it will generate between 12-14v at around 9 to a maximum of 14Amps.
